so ive been trying to get my APRS setup working properly and im losing my mind a little. running a TM-D710G connected to a raspberry pi with direwolf, feeding into APRS-IS through an ethernet connection. the radio is beaconing fine, i can hear my own packets come back out of the speaker and direwolf is decoding them, but when i check aprs.fi i sometimes see my position and sometimes i dont. its totally random. sometimes it shows up within 30 seconds, sometimes not for like 10 minutes, sometimes not at all.
i checked the path and im using WIDE1-1,WIDE2-1 which should be getting picked up by the local digis. there are at least 3 digipeaters within range according to the map. RF environment seems decent, im running 50 watts into a vertical on the roof. the thing that really confuses me is that direwolf shows good decode quality on its own packets when it hears them come back, so the RF side seems okay.
anyone dealt with this kind of intermittent thing before? starting to wonder if its a timing issue with my beacon interval or maybe the IGate closest to me is having issues. set to beacon every 2 minutes right now.
